Magnuson begins to narrow list

Erik Magnuson has started to trim schools off his impressive offer list but the Carlsbad (Calif.) La Costa Canyon offensive tackle said he's not ready to publicly divulge which schools are making the cut just yet.
Cal and Oklahoma are the two latest offers for Magnuson, a 6-foot-6, 275-pound prospect who was one of the best offensive tackles last weekend at the Stanford NIKE Camp. Rivals.com rates him No. 35 in the 2012 class.

"I've started narrowing it down a little bit in my head but I haven't come out with anything yet," Magnuson said.
"I think I'm going to sit down over the next couple weeks, looking at every school, seeing what they can do for me and hopefully I'll have a top five by the season and then go on my official visits from there."
Arizona, Boise State, Cincinnati, Colorado, Colorado State, Miami, Michigan, Notre Dame, Oregon, Oregon State, San Diego State, San Jose State, Stanford, UCLA, Utah, Washington and Washington State have also offered Magnuson, who said he'd like to take all five official trips.
Magnuson has talked highly about many programs in the past including Oregon, Miami, Notre Dame and Michigan but since he's not giving out any favorites at this point it's still anyone's guess on which teams are leading.
Since he plans to take all five official visits this fall, Magnuson is still probably months away from making his commitment.
He said Sunday at Stanford that recruiting has slowed down a little bit but that it's been fun to see numerous coaching staffs stop by his school.
"Recruiting is going well," Magnuson said.
"It's slowing down for a little bit but it was going pretty heavy there for a little while. The coaches are coming into the school now. I haven't gotten any new offers yet but when the coaches come in that's been fun."
